Polsinelli Shughart gets revised HQ design from Highwoods Properties in Atlanta
Published: 01-Sep-2010
Highwoods Properties, a North Carolina-headquartered real estate investment trust (REIT), has unveiled a revised conceptual rendering of the proposed eight-storey national headquarters building for American law firm Polsinelli Shughart PC, in Kansas City.
The new rendering of the $57 million HQ building, located in the heart of the historic Country Club Plaza, has been created by incorporating suggestions from the community, patrons of the plaza and city officials. The revised design preserves the Balcony Building and streetscape, besides allowing for an efficient and environmentally-responsible building.
Some of the changes to the streetscape and building include maintenance of the architectural and thematic integrity of the Balcony Building; preservation of the ‘Balcony Tower’ and the two-storey structure at the corner of 47th and Broadway Streets; and preservation of all existing trees along 47th Street.
The existing parking deck behind the Balcony Building, upon which the office building will be situated, will feature architectural precast concrete panels that will be textured with detailing corresponding to similar buildings within the plaza. Some of this detailing will also be incorporated into the façade of the office building
The colour of the materials of the parking deck and office building facades will be a warmer tone than previously conceived, which will be more harmonious with the Balcony Building and the plaza. In the previous rendering the colour was light-gray tone, which has been changed to pale-brownish tone. The building will be set back 70ft, which is exactly where the 12-storey Valencia Place building is located off the curb line.
The 192,000 square feet Class A office building will be Leadership in Energy and Environmental Design (LEED) certified. It will bear the Polsinelli Shughart signage and will complement the traditional design of other plaza office and retail buildings.
Polsinelli Shughart PC’s two Kansas City, Missouri, office locations would merge into a new, $57 million, national headquarters building, which will be developed and owned by Highwoods Properties. The HQ project is scheduled for completion sometime in late 2013.
